.Mystical regions in the deep wrap where quake surges slow-moving to a crawl might in fact be anywhere, brand new investigation finds.Scientists presently understood that ultra-low rate regions (ULVZs), float near hotspots-- areas of the wrap where hot rock moves upward, forming excitable island establishments such as Hawaii. Yet strange earthquake surges recommend that these components might be widespread.ULVZs, which are located in the lesser wrap near the core-mantle limit, may reduce seismic surges through around 50%. That's exceptional, claimed Michael Thorne, a rock hound as well as geophysicist at the Educational institution of Utah." Listed below is among the absolute most excessive components that we see anywhere inside the world," Thorne informed Live Scientific research. "As well as our experts do not recognize what they are actually, where they're arising from, what they're crafted from, [or even] what job they play inside the Earth." Thorne had not been thinking of ULVZs when he released the new study, released Aug. 10 in the diary AGU Innovations. As an alternative, he was fascinated by yet another mantle enigma. Big quakes, like those that happen at subduction regions where one structural layer slides under an additional, launch strong surges. A few of these alleged PKP waves journey via the mantle, the liquefied external primary, and after that the mantle once more on their technique to the opposite edge of the world where they came from. These waves are in some cases come before through yet another strange sort of surge, referred to as a prototype PKP wave.Precursor PKP waves come in before the principal surge after dispersing off secret components in The planet's lower mantle. To identify these functions, Thorne and also his associates created PKP surges journeying through a pc style of The planet's mantle, into which they added locations that transformed the surges' velocity. They discovered expected patterns in how PKP waves varied in speed.So the staff looked for comparable trends in true earthquake information. The analysts made use of information coming from 58 deeper quakes with immensities over 5.8 near New Guinea that developed between 2008 as well as 2022. Surges coming from these quakes took a trip by means of the core and up to The United States and Canada, where they were documented by EarthScope, a venture that set up transportable seismic monitors throughout the USA in between 2003 and also 2018. Receive the world's most exciting findings provided straight to your inbox.The results proposed that something was significantly slowing the earthquake waves to scatter their electricity, Thorne pointed out. The 2 likely prospects were lowlands and also spines along the core-mantle border where the waves journeyed, or ULVZs. The core-mantle boundary under the western Pacific, where the waves passed, is actually thought to be smooth. But previous research found a large ULVZ under the western Pacific, eastern of the Philippines, overlapping the area studied.And the researchers additionally located signatures of ULVZs when they searched somewhere else. The study found smaller patches of what seem to be to become more ULVZs under North America. And other investigation has located signs of ULVZs under North Africa, East Asia, Papua New Guinea and the Pacific Northwest, Thorne said.Some scientists have actually theorized that ULVZs could be the remainders of large impactors coming from Earth's beginning of meteor bombardment. However, if ULVZs are widespread, it advises they're being actually definitely created today, Thorne mentioned. He thinks that these regions might be actually areas of the excitable stone lava, created at mid-ocean spines where the seafloor spreads apart. When this mid-ocean lava inevitably obtains taken in to the wrap through subduction, it liquefies conveniently as well as could form wallets where seismic waves slow. These pockets can then obtain pushed around the wrap by various other pieces of subducting shell, which poke in to Planet's interior like stirring penetrate a smoothie.Better recognizing these ULVZs can strengthen rock hounds' knowledge of volcanic hotspots in addition to how the wrap moves."
